Reproduction Upper Missouri or Transmontane (Northern Plains & Plateau) style hairbows handcrafted by me in 2020.

The ornament consists of two main parts: a bow-tie and a long drop. Bow-tie portion is made of red-dyed elk parflesh, covered with red cloth patches to which in several rows smooth dentallia, antique pound beads and a corrugated brass tube are attached. On the drop portion, antique Italian crow beads, hairpipes, braintan hide, real sinew, natural silk and ermine tails are used.
Manufacture year: 2020 Tribal style: Arikara, Crow, Hidatsa, Mandan, Yankton Sioux, Yanktonai Sioux Finishing: Artificial patina Metal: Brass
Materials: Bone hairpipe *, Dentalium *, Ermine fur *, Metal beads *, Natural silk *, Pound (pony) beads *, Real sinew *, Trade cloth *
